Technical Description

The LK Machinery CMC-3555 Vertical Machining Center is a high-performance CNC machine engineered for precision and versatility in demanding machining environments. Featuring a robust "A" shaped wide-stance column and box-in-box construction, it delivers exceptional rigidity and stability for heavy-duty cutting operations. The machine offers 21.7 inches of X-axis travel, 15.7 inches of Y-axis travel, and 16.5 inches of Z-axis travel, accommodating a wide range of workpiece sizes. The worktable measures 13.8 inches by 13.8 inches, providing a stable platform for complex machining tasks. Equipped with a 7.5 hp spindle motor and a maximum spindle speed of 12,000 RPM, the CMC-3555 ensures efficient material removal and high-quality surface finishes. The spindle taper is BT-30, supporting a variety of tooling options for diverse applications. The machine features a 20-tool automatic tool changer (ATC) for rapid tool changes and increased productivity. Designed for advanced 5-axis machining, the CMC-3555 enables the production of intricate and complex parts with high accuracy. The overall dimensions of the machine are 132.2 inches in length, 68.9 inches in width, and 114.2 inches in height, with a total weight of 10,714 lbs, reflecting its sturdy build and industrial-grade construction. This machining center is ideal for shops requiring high efficiency, precision, and flexibility in their manufacturing processes.
